Poliwag was sleeping very soundly. Mai explained to the slightly panicked girl that most Pokémon who have difficulty hatching tend to behave like this; they'll naturally wake up when they get hungry, so there's no need to be nervous.

The girl's name was Claire. Her parents were both born in the Kalos Region, but now they were settled in Hearthome City. In her own words, she considered herself a native of Sinnoh.

During Poliwag's deep sleep, Claire constantly exchanged tips and experiences with Mai about raising Pokémon. This was the first time she was personally taking care of a Pokémon.

Claire sat on the ground with Poliwag sleeping soundly in her arms, occasionally blowing a bubble. Mai took several measurements of Poliwag's physical data. While it looked a bit skinny, it didn't appear to have any major issues.

"These days, people who actually attend school diligently and only start traveling after acquiring a solid foundation of knowledge are a very rare breed,"

Claire said with a laugh as she described the scene at her school, something that surprised Luther, who had never experienced this world's school system before.

According to Claire's description, the basic academies were not that different from those in Luther's original world, aside from the curriculum's different focus, primarily centered around Pokémon knowledge.

Class sizes like Claire's, no more than twenty students, were almost unimaginable to Luther, since his classes had never had fewer than forty or fifty students.

Not everyone in those schools aspired to become Pokémon Trainers either. Most students enrolled with the hope of securing more stable and promising careers in the future, and a group of people who had already planned out their lives in advance.

There were, of course, specialized schools specifically for Pokémon Trainers, but Claire had never attended one, so she wasn't too familiar with the details.

As they chatted idly, Poliwag slowly opened its eyes, still groggy and dazed. It blinked sleepily at Claire, then looked around.

With everyone watching curiously, Poliwag hesitated for a moment… and then started crying.

Claire panicked, thinking she had done something to make Poliwag uncomfortable. Luckily, Luther and Mai reacted quickly. Just then, Chansey and Eevee, who had gone to prepare Pokémon food, came back carrying a feeding bowl.

For some reason, Luther felt like Chansey looked a little frustrated, and Eevee also seemed a bit annoyed.

Mai took the feeding bowl and was just about to hand it to Poliwag when Luther stopped her.

Poliwag stared at the food, drooling, but didn't move. He vaguely understood that the person holding him, Claire, was the one who would be raising him, so he held back, drooling as he gazed at her with eager eyes.

"What's wrong?" Claire was also a little confused.

Luther's gesture snapped Mai out of her daze. She sniffed the food in the bowl and frowned.

"This smells like... Ink Pecha Berry."

Mai choked and coughed a little. Luther quickly handed her some water.

The name of the berry sounded unfamiliar, it was probably another unique berry of this world.

After taking a few sips of water and recovering, Mai continued, "Normally, this kind of berry is used to help newborn, weak Pokémon regain energy. Because it has a very intense flavor, after eating it, the baby Pokémon feels warm and cozy, even fragile ones will perk up and make it through the most dangerous observation period."

"That... actually sounds like exactly what we need, doesn't it?" Luther let out a sigh of relief.

Mai looked like she wanted to explain something, but after several false starts, she clenched her fists, picked up the feeding bowl, pushed the door open, and walked out with an icy expression on her face.

Before Luther could even figure out what was going on, Mai had already disappeared down the corridor.

Claire was just as confused. She had heard about the effects of that berry and knew it was supposed to be beneficial for Poliwag, so why did Mai seem so upset?

The one who was most distressed was Poliwag. He watched as the food in front of him was suddenly taken away. His eyes welled up with tears, thinking that his new trainer was displeased with him, and he began to cry again, this time, no amount of comforting from Claire seemed to work.

Chansey came over carrying an empty bowl, placed it in front of Claire, and then pulled an egg out of her pouch. She gently cracked it open.

A rich, mouth-watering aroma wafted through the air. Poliwag immediately stopped crying and sniffled as he inhaled the sweet scent in the air, watching as Chansey carefully poured the golden egg liquid into the bowl.

Holding the bowl filled with golden yolk, Chansey nudged it closer to Poliwag.

Claire hesitated. She wasn't sure if it was safe for a newborn Poliwag to eat something like this, plus, it seemed that Chansey belonged to Luther. Would this be considered overstepping?

Even so, Poliwag, despite being tempted by the aroma, held himself back, waiting for Claire's permission.

"Let him eat. According to the Pokédex, eggs laid by a Chansey are extremely nutritious."

The moment she heard the word "Pokédex," Claire made up her mind.

"Go ahead, eat."

Poliwag immediately dove into the bowl, eagerly sucking down the egg liquid face-first. Chansey could only set the bowl down and retreat back to Luther's side.

Watching Poliwag eat so happily, Claire blushed and said, "It should've been my responsibility to think of a solution. Sorry for troubling your Chansey."

"It's no trouble at all. I often ask Chansey to cook me an omelet as a midnight snack. Eating eggs is no big deal for me."

Luther's words made Chansey chuckle as well.

"You're a Pokédex holder?"

"Yeah, oh, right, I haven't introduced myself yet. Luther, from Sandgem Town."

Luther used to think of himself as someone from Twinleaf Town. But after what happened with Shiran, he felt there was nothing left in Twinleaf worth holding onto.

Claire repeated Luther's name a few times, as if trying to recall something.

"You're that guy, the one who tutored Basil, and helped him go on a winning streak among Trainers his age?"

"Huh?" It took Luther a moment to process. "I guess… if the Basil you're talking about is the apprentice Trainer from the Hearthome City Gym I know…"

"I knew it!" Claire's voice startled Poliwag, who accidentally spat out a mouthful of egg liquid with a splurt. She quickly grabbed a towel to wipe his face.

Once Poliwag caught his breath and resumed eating, Claire continued, "I never expected to run into you here."

"From your reaction… am I supposed to be famous or something?" Luther was completely baffled.

"There are stories about you floating around in the Hearthome City youth Pokémon Trainer circles."

Claire thought for a moment and added, "For example, when you first joined the Veilstone Gym, you apparently beat up every Trainer who came to challenge the Gym. You also had a 2-on-2 battle with the then-shy Basil and helped him shine during the fight. Ever since then, Basil's been on a winning streak. Plus, people say you're no longer accepting new apprentice Trainer students…"

What kind of nonsense is all this?

Where were these rumors even coming from? This is just ridiculous!
